Filmed in front of a live audience, this series features stand-up monologues from award-winning comedian Sarah Millican, inspired by what she has seen on television. She also chats with the people she loves to watch on screen, with an interview technique that is all her own. Taking a fun look at the television shows she adores, Sarah introduces her audience to her personal favourite (if somewhat unlikely) genre combinations; Property & Fashion, Food & Survival, Sports & Entertainment, Drama & Weather, Crime & Medical and Dating & Wildlife. Joining Sarah, during the series, to talk about their fields of screen expertise, are a number of TV practitioners: wildlife authority Chris Packham, 'sexpert' Tracey Cox, property guru Sarah Beeny, fashionista Julien MacDonald, economic soothsayer Robert Peston, medicine woman Pixie McKenna, and crime sleuth Rav Wilding. Also appearing are: baker extraordinaire Paul Hollywood, adventurer Charlie Boorman, TV Sommelier Olly Smith, sports commentator Clare Balding, Olympic gymnast Beth Tweddle, dancer Louie Spence, thespian Simon Callow, meteorologist John Kettley and leading lady Phyllis Logan.
